Windows: come posso vedere lo spazio su disco utilizzato nel tempo?


12

Sto cercando un modo per acquisire e visualizzare lo spazio su disco usato nel tempo. Tutto ciò di cui ho bisogno è un numero-- byte usati sul disco. Memorizzo molte foto sul mio computer, quindi ho bisogno di un modo per stimare quando avrò bisogno di più spazio sul disco rigido. Se c'è un modo per catturare lo spazio su disco usato con una risoluzione oraria sarebbe fantastico, ma anche la risoluzione giornaliera va bene. Non ho nemmeno bisogno di una visualizzazione dei dati; fintanto che i dati sono facilmente esportabili in Excel, posso creare il mio grafico ed estrapolare.

Ho visto molti programmi di visualizzazione dello spazio su disco come WinDirStat e TreeSizeFree, ma non hanno un modo per automatizzare l'acquisizione dello spazio su disco nel tempo.



Grazie @Matthew Lock. Sembra che Performance Monitor mostri solo l'ultimo minuto nella vista. Ho bisogno di qualcosa che possa tenere traccia degli anni. Sai se esiste un modo per farlo utilizzando Performance Monitor?
Patrick,

Puoi cambiare il tempo di campionamento qui: i.imgur.com/ganlFBW.png In realtà non ho provato anni in pratica, ma sembra funzionare.
Matthew Lock,

Risposte:


12

È possibile visualizzare lo spazio su disco utilizzato nel tempo con Windows Performance Monitor (perfmon) fino all'MB con una risoluzione fino a un secondo. Questo strumento è integrato nelle ultime versioni di Windows, quindi non è nemmeno necessario scaricare un altro programma per visualizzare i dati. Non mostra alcun dato precedente, quindi vedrai solo i dati sullo spazio su disco da quando li hai impostati. Avevo solo bisogno di punti dati orari ma ho provato con gli aggiornamenti ogni secondo e ha funzionato bene.

Perfmon consente di generare la quantità di spazio libero su disco disponibile come valori in un file separato da virgole (può essere aperto in Excel), separato da tabulazioni (ciò che Excel utilizza abitualmente) o binario. Utilizzando l'output binario, è possibile visualizzare i dati nel perfmon stesso. L'uso di uno degli altri tipi di output consente di creare grafici personalizzati dei dati in Excel.

Ecco una guida dettagliata su come configurarlo:

  1. Apri Performance Monitor di Windows (Win-R -> digita "perfmon.exe" -> Invio)
  2. Nel riquadro più a sinistra, fai doppio clic Data Collector Sets. Tasto destro del mouse User Defined-> New-> Data Collector Set.
  3. Inserisci un nome per il tuo set, qualcosa come "Spazio su disco libero". Fare clic sul pulsante di opzione Create manually (Advanced), fare clic su Avanti.
  4. Controlla Performance counter, fai clic su Avanti
  5. Clic Add...
  6. Scorri fino a visualizzare LogicalDiske fai clic sulla freccia giù accanto ad essa. Scorri leggermente verso il basso e fai clic Free Megabytes(puoi anche selezionare % Free Spacese lo desideri). Ora nella casella qui sotto intitolata Instance of selected object:clicca C:e poi sotto quella Add >>. Quel contatore ora dovrebbe apparire nel riquadro destro intitolato Added counters. Clicca OK.
  7. Impostare su Sample Intervalper quanto spesso desideri che i dati vengano raccolti. Come ho già detto, volevo vedere i punti di dati orari. Così, ho messo 1in Sample Intervale cambiato Unitsa Hours. Fai clic su Avanti.
  8. Seleziona la posizione in cui desideri che si trovino i tuoi registri. Fai clic su Fine.
  9. Fare doppio clic User Definednel pannello di sinistra e fare clic sul set di raccolta dati appena creato (il nome di esempio era "Spazio su disco libero").
  10. Il set di raccolta dati che hai appena creato dovrebbe apparire nel pannello di destra. Fai clic destro -> Properties.
  11. Sotto Log formatpuoi selezionare il tipo che preferisci secondo la spiegazione nel paragrafo sopra. Clicca OK.

Se hai selezionato binario, puoi visualizzare i dati facendo clic su Reports-> User Defined-> Disk Space Freenel riquadro a sinistra, quindi facendo doppio clic sull'elemento nel riquadro a destra.

Se si è scelto separato da virgole o separato da tabulazioni, è possibile visualizzare i dati nella posizione specificata nel passaggio 8.


1
Questa dovrebbe essere contrassegnata come la risposta giusta
Wadih M.

1
@WadihM. hai ragione. Secondo le descrizioni StackExchange dovrei votare la risposta di Matthew ("questa risposta è utile") e selezionare la mia come risposta corretta. Sono andato avanti e l'ho fatto.
Patrick

1

2
Grazie per questi link. Speravo ci fosse un modo per farlo attraverso un programma. Ho finito per usare il tuo primo suggerimento. Dopo essermi tuffato un po 'di più in Window Performance Monitor, ho scoperto come impostare un set di raccolta dati definito dall'utente e vedere i dati tramite la funzione di report. Accetto la tua risposta perché ti meriti il ​​merito di avermi indicato la risposta giusta nel tuo commento. Ma aggiungerò anche il mio per chiunque voglia farlo senza script.
Patrick,

1
In qualità di Super utente di grande valore, ti incoraggio a rivisitare questa risposta e aggiungere ulteriori dettagli. Come forse saprai, i collegamenti ipertestuali da soli puntano verso una risposta senza effettivamente esserlo . Si prega di modificare la risposta in modo che includa gli elementi essenziali dei collegamenti.
Dico Reinstate Monica il

@Patrick Per favore, imposta la tua risposta come corretta
Wadih M.
Utilizzando il nostro sito, riconosci di aver letto e compreso le nostre Informativa sui cookie e Informativa sulla privacy.
Licensed under cc by-sa 3.0 with attribution required.